The Greek Catholic Co-cathedral of Saints Cyril and Methodius (Croatian: Grkokatolička konkatedrala Sv.
Ćirila i Metoda) is the historicistic co-cathedral church of the Greek Catholic Eparchy of Križevci.
It is located in the Street of St. Cyril and Methodius on the Upper Town in Zagreb, near St. Mark's Square.
A Greek Catholic church and seminary (built in 1681) existed on the Upper Town before the 17th century.
This church was intended for the Greek Catholic believers, mostly people from Žumberak Mountains, Uskoks and clerics that lived in and around Zagreb.
